]> git.baikalelectronics.ru Git - kernel.git/commit
l2tp: Fix PPP header erasure and memory leak
authorGuillaume Nault <g.nault@alphalink.fr>
Wed, 12 Jun 2013 14:07:23 +0000 (16:07 +0200)
committerDavid S. Miller <davem@davemloft.net>
Thu, 13 Jun 2013 09:39:04 +0000 (02:39 -0700)
commitf701631099ab3ba6b9ff77988cb24cb5bbe06cc9
tree514fe980a7da487b07d52f2821a90820e59026fa
parent08e87d4e33b5e01fadafe314975c7be8e2cd967a
l2tp: Fix PPP header erasure and memory leak

Copy user data after PPP framing header. This prevents erasure of the
added PPP header and avoids leaking two bytes of uninitialised memory
at the end of skb's data buffer.

Signed-off-by: Guillaume Nault <g.nault@alphalink.fr>
Signed-off-by: David S. Miller <davem@davemloft.net>
net/l2tp/l2tp_ppp.c